Verdict

Seattle, WA offers better overall compensation for police officers, winning 3 out of 4 metrics compared to Renton.

The salary gap between Renton and Seattle is $13,092 (12.40%). Seattle's median is +51.06% compared to the US national median of $78,542.

Salary Range Comparison

The full salary range (10th to 90th percentile) in Renton spans $94,509,Seattle spans $43,100. Renton has a wider pay range, meaning more potential for high earners but also more variation.

Cost-of-Living Adjusted Comparison

After cost-of-living adjustment, Seattle ($106,758 effective) pays 8.63% more than Renton ($98,278 effective).

Historical Salary Growth Comparison

Based on B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, police officer salaries in Renton grew 5.6% from 2024 to 2025, compared to 32.0% growth in Seattle over the same period.

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 3.06%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
